Factors to Consider When Choosing Knife Storage Solutions Tiny Kitchens
Choosing the right knife storage solution for tiny kitchens involves understanding how each option impacts your limited space, safety, and convenience. Beyond size, consider how accessible and secure your knives will be, as well as the material durability and installation process. Picking a solution that matches your collection size avoids overcrowding or underutilization, while ensuring safety reduces the risk of accidents. Carefully weighing these factors helps you find a storage method that complements your kitchen layout and lifestyle, making daily meal prep safer and more efficient.Size and Capacity
Assess your knife collection and measure available space before choosing a storage solution. Small drawers or wall mounts are ideal for limited space, but they must also accommodate your typical number of knives without overcrowding. Overly large organizers may waste precious space, while too-small options can lead to clutter or safety issues. Aim for a balance where knives are accessible but not cramped, ensuring safety and efficiency in tight quarters.
Material and Durability
Materials like bamboo, plastic, and metal each have pros and cons. Bamboo offers a natural look and is gentle on blades but can warp over time if not well-maintained. Plastic is lightweight and affordable but may wear or crack with frequent use. Metal racks are durable and often look sleek, but they might be heavier or more expensive. Consider your cleaning routines and how much wear and tear your storage will face to pick a material that lasts.
Safety Features
In tiny kitchens, safety is especially important due to close quarters. Look for solutions with blade guards, soft-close drawers, or non-slip bases to prevent accidents. Wall-mounted racks should have secure mounting hardware to avoid slips or falls. Avoid solutions that leave blades exposed or are hard to access quickly, as they increase the risk of cuts or injuries in small spaces crowded with other kitchen tools.
Ease of Installation and Maintenance
Choose a product that fits your DIY comfort level. Drawer organizers typically require minimal setup but may need to be removed for cleaning. Wall-mounted options need proper mounting hardware and may involve drilling, which could be a concern in rented spaces. Regular cleaning and blade maintenance are essential to prevent rust or buildup, especially in humid environments. Consider how much effort you’re willing to invest in upkeep when choosing your storage solution.
Aesthetic and Space Compatibility
Your kitchen’s style and available space should influence your choice. Sleek plastic or minimalist metal racks blend well with modern kitchens, while bamboo adds warmth to rustic or traditional spaces. For extremely tight areas, vertical or under-cabinet wall mounts can free up drawer space. Be mindful of how the solution integrates with your overall kitchen aesthetic and whether it complements or clashes with your existing decor.

How do I prevent knives from getting dull in small storage solutions?
Proper storage is key to maintaining blade sharpness, regardless of size. Avoid overcrowding that causes blades to rub against each other, which dulls edges. Use organizers with individual slots or blade guards to prevent contact. Regularly cleaning and honing your knives also helps preserve sharpness over time. Choosing a storage solution that keeps blades protected from damage is essential in small kitchens where space constraints can lead to cluttered or unsafe conditions.

Are bamboo knife organizers better than plastic for tiny kitchens?
Bamboo organizers are often preferred for their durability, natural look, and gentle treatment of blades, making them suitable for frequent use. They add warmth and style to small kitchens and tend to be more eco-friendly. Plastic options are more affordable and lightweight but can wear quickly or crack over time, especially with frequent handling. Your choice should balance durability, aesthetics, and ease of cleaning to ensure long-term satisfaction in tight spaces.
